okay so when my cars warmed up the idle while drop down to 400-500 then it will go up to 650-750 for a min which is when you can actually hear the cams then it drops back down and the sound of the cams go away i thought i needed to adjust my bov (greddy type s) and found out that the threads are all f**ked up but when i took the screw off while the car was running the idle was near perfect...? i put my finger over the hole went back to a hesitation took it off idled normal agian... so i put the stock bov on and it didnt help anyone know what this can be?!?!
 
Are you on stock tune, link,etc? Just an Idea (I may be wrong) but if it was leaking before, and the a/f was calibrated with the leak, then fixing the leak would change your a/f and cause idle problems. Like I said, just a thought.

the cars never been tuned i have 550 injectors and hks 272/264 cams if this is the case is there anyway to fix it or do i have to get it tuned
 
if you have bigger cams, you really should have a tune to go along with them. Otherwise, the added duration and overlap can cause problems.

OP, I think you have something called idle surge, look into that using the search feature.

Could also be some other small things. Boost leak, vacuum leak, ect. Might be a misfire dropping your RPMs then your ECU corrects it and brings it back up to compensate.
